    Abstract: A switching power supply with a resonant converter has an AC to DC converter and a DC to DC converter. The AC to DC converter converts an inputted AC power into a DC power. The DC to DC converter has a resonant converter determining a current operating state according to waveforms of a transformer voltage and a driving signal actually measured and further controlling a switching frequency of the resonant converter to approach or to be equal to a resonant frequency for operational efficiency enhancement. Accordingly, the failure to accurately calculate a resonant frequency beforehand can be solved and the issue of accurately keeping the switching frequency consistent with the resonant frequency can be tackled.

    Abstract: A feed forward controlling circuit is used to perform a feed forward controlling method to restrain ripple of the output voltage in a power converter. The power converter is controlled by a control signal outputted from an output terminal of a controller. The method includes steps of: receiving an output voltage from an output terminal of a voltage converter; attenuating the output voltage to generate an electrical signal; acquiring a DC signal from the electrical signal; and obtaining a ripple compensation signal in accordance with the electrical signal and the DC signal to output to an output terminal of a controller. The output terminal of the controller outputs a control signal to control the power converter.
